// podStatusManagerStateFile is the file name where status manager stores its state
const podStatusManagerStateFile = "pod_status_manager_state"
// A wrapper around v1.PodStatus that includes a version to enforce that stale pod statuses are
// not sent to the API server.
type versionedPodStatus struct {
// version is a monotonically increasing version number (per pod).
version uint64
// Pod name & namespace, for sending updates to API server.
podName string
podNamespace string
// at is the time at which the most recent status update was detected
at time.Time
// True if the status is generated at the end of SyncTerminatedPod, or after it is completed.
podIsFinished bool
status v1.PodStatus
}
// Updates pod statuses in apiserver. Writes only when new status has changed.
// All methods are thread-safe.
type manager struct {
kubeClient clientset.Interface
podManager PodManager
// Map from pod UID to sync status of the corresponding pod.
podStatuses map[types.UID]versionedPodStatus
podStatusesLock sync.RWMutex
podStatusChannel chan struct{}
// Map from (mirror) pod UID to latest status version successfully sent to the API server.
// apiStatusVersions must only be accessed from the sync thread.
apiStatusVersions map[kubetypes.MirrorPodUID]uint64
podDeletionSafety PodDeletionSafetyProvider
podStartupLatencyHelper PodStartupLatencyStateHelper
// state allows to save/restore pod resource allocation and tolerate kubelet restarts.
state state.State
// stateFileDirectory holds the directory where the state file for checkpoints is held.
stateFileDirectory string
}
// PodManager is the subset of methods the manager needs to observe the actual state of the kubelet.
// See pkg/k8s.io/kubernetes/pkg/kubelet/pod.Manager for method godoc.
type PodManager interface {
GetPodByUID(types.UID) (*v1.Pod, bool)
GetMirrorPodByPod(*v1.Pod) (*v1.Pod, bool)
TranslatePodUID(uid types.UID) kubetypes.ResolvedPodUID
GetUIDTranslations() (podToMirror map[kubetypes.ResolvedPodUID]kubetypes.MirrorPodUID, mirrorToPod map[kubetypes.MirrorPodUID]kubetypes.ResolvedPodUID)
}
// PodStatusProvider knows how to provide status for a pod. It is intended to be used by other components
// that need to introspect the authoritative status of a pod. The PodStatusProvider represents the actual
// status of a running pod as the kubelet sees it.
type PodStatusProvider interface {
// GetPodStatus returns the cached status for the provided pod UID, as well as whether it
// was a cache hit.
GetPodStatus(uid types.UID) (v1.PodStatus, bool)
}
// PodDeletionSafetyProvider provides guarantees that a pod can be safely deleted.
type PodDeletionSafetyProvider interface {
// PodCouldHaveRunningContainers returns true if the pod could have running containers.
PodCouldHaveRunningContainers(pod *v1.Pod) bool
}
type PodStartupLatencyStateHelper interface {
RecordStatusUpdated(pod *v1.Pod)
DeletePodStartupState(podUID types.UID)
}
// Manager is the Source of truth for kubelet pod status, and should be kept up-to-date with
// the latest v1.PodStatus. It also syncs updates back to the API server.
type Manager interface {
PodStatusProvider
// Start the API server status sync loop.
Start()
// SetPodStatus caches updates the cached status for the given pod, and triggers a status update.
SetPodStatus(pod *v1.Pod, status v1.PodStatus)
// SetContainerReadiness updates the cached container status with the given readiness, and
// triggers a status update.
SetContainerReadiness(podUID types.UID, containerID kubecontainer.ContainerID, ready bool)
// SetContainerStartup updates the cached container status with the given startup, and
// triggers a status update.
SetContainerStartup(podUID types.UID, containerID kubecontainer.ContainerID, started bool)
// TerminatePod resets the container status for the provided pod to terminated and triggers
// a status update.
TerminatePod(pod *v1.Pod)
// RemoveOrphanedStatuses scans the status cache and removes any entries for pods not included in
// the provided podUIDs.
RemoveOrphanedStatuses(podUIDs map[types.UID]bool)
// GetContainerResourceAllocation returns checkpointed AllocatedResources value for the container
GetContainerResourceAllocation(podUID string, containerName string) (v1.ResourceList, bool)
// GetPodResizeStatus returns checkpointed PodStatus.Resize value
GetPodResizeStatus(podUID string) (v1.PodResizeStatus, bool)
// SetPodAllocation checkpoints the resources allocated to a pod's containers.
SetPodAllocation(pod *v1.Pod) error
// SetPodResizeStatus checkpoints the last resizing decision for the pod.
SetPodResizeStatus(podUID types.UID, resize v1.PodResizeStatus) error
}

// TerminatePod ensures that the status of containers is properly defaulted at the end of the pod
// lifecycle. As the Kubelet must reconcile with the container runtime to observe container status
// there is always the possibility we are unable to retrieve one or more container statuses due to
// garbage collection, admin action, or loss of temporary data on a restart. This method ensures
// that any absent container status is treated as a failure so that we do not incorrectly describe
// the pod as successful. If we have not yet initialized the pod in the presence of init containers,
// the init container failure status is sufficient to describe the pod as failing, and we do not need
// to override waiting containers (unless there is evidence the pod previously started those containers).
// It also makes sure that pods are transitioned to a terminal phase (Failed or Succeeded) before
// their deletion.
func (m *manager) TerminatePod(pod *v1.Pod) {
m.podStatusesLock.Lock()
defer m.podStatusesLock.Unlock()
// ensure that all containers have a terminated state - because we do not know whether the container
// was successful, always report an error
oldStatus := &pod.Status
cachedStatus, isCached := m.podStatuses[pod.UID]
if isCached {
oldStatus = &cachedStatus.status
}
status := *oldStatus.DeepCopy()
// once a pod has initialized, any missing status is treated as a failure
if hasPodInitialized(pod) {
for i := range status.ContainerStatuses {
if status.ContainerStatuses[i].State.Terminated != nil {
continue
}
status.ContainerStatuses[i].State = v1.ContainerState{
Terminated: &v1.ContainerStateTerminated{
Reason: "ContainerStatusUnknown",
Message: "The container could not be located when the pod was terminated",
ExitCode: 137,
},
}
}
}
// all but the final suffix of init containers which have no evidence of a container start are
// marked as failed containers
for i := range initializedContainers(status.InitContainerStatuses) {
if status.InitContainerStatuses[i].State.Terminated != nil {
continue
}
status.InitContainerStatuses[i].State = v1.ContainerState{
Terminated: &v1.ContainerStateTerminated{
Reason: "ContainerStatusUnknown",
Message: "The container could not be located when the pod was terminated",
ExitCode: 137,
},
}
}
// Make sure all pods are transitioned to a terminal phase.
// TODO(#116484): Also assign terminal phase to static an pods.
if !kubetypes.IsStaticPod(pod) {
switch status.Phase {
case v1.PodSucceeded, v1.PodFailed:
// do nothing, already terminal
case v1.PodPending, v1.PodRunning:
if status.Phase == v1.PodRunning && isCached {
klog.InfoS("Terminal running pod should have already been marked as failed, programmer error",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
}
klog.V(3).InfoS("Marking terminal pod as failed", "oldPhase", status.Phase, "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
status.Phase = v1.PodFailed
default:
klog.ErrorS(fmt.Errorf("unknown phase: %v", status.Phase), "Unknown phase, programmer error",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
status.Phase = v1.PodFailed
}
}
klog.V(5).InfoS("TerminatePod calling updateStatusInternal",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
m.updateStatusInternal(pod, status, true, true)
}
// hasPodInitialized returns true if the pod has no evidence of ever starting a regular container, which
// implies those containers should not be transitioned to terminated status.
func hasPodInitialized(pod *v1.Pod) bool {
// a pod without init containers is always initialized
if len(pod.Spec.InitContainers) == 0 {
return true
}
// if any container has ever moved out of waiting state, the pod has initialized
for _, status := range pod.Status.ContainerStatuses {
if status.LastTerminationState.Terminated != nil || status.State.Waiting == nil {
return true
}
}
// if the last init container has ever completed with a zero exit code, the pod is initialized
if l := len(pod.Status.InitContainerStatuses); l > 0 {
container, ok := kubeutil.GetContainerByIndex(pod.Spec.InitContainers, pod.Status.InitContainerStatuses, l-1)
if !ok {
klog.V(4).InfoS("Mismatch between pod spec and status, likely programmer error",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"containerName", container.Name)
return false
}
containerStatus := pod.Status.InitContainerStatuses[l-1]
if kubetypes.IsRestartableInitContainer(&container) {
if containerStatus.State.Running != nil &&
containerStatus.Started != nil && *containerStatus.Started {
return true
}
} else { // regular init container
if state := containerStatus.LastTerminationState; state.Terminated != nil && state.Terminated.ExitCode == 0 {
return true
}
if state := containerStatus.State; state.Terminated != nil && state.Terminated.ExitCode == 0 {
return true
}
}
}
// otherwise the pod has no record of being initialized
return false
}
// initializedContainers returns all status except for suffix of containers that are in Waiting
// state, which is the set of containers that have attempted to start at least once. If all containers
// are Waiting, the first container is always returned.
func initializedContainers(containers []v1.ContainerStatus) []v1.ContainerStatus {
for i := len(containers) - 1; i >= 0; i-- {
if containers[i].State.Waiting == nil || containers[i].LastTerminationState.Terminated != nil {
return containers[0 : i+1]
}
}
// always return at least one container
if len(containers) > 0 {
return containers[0:1]
}
return nil
}
// checkContainerStateTransition ensures that no container is trying to transition
// from a terminated to non-terminated state, which is illegal and indicates a
// logical error in the kubelet.
func checkContainerStateTransition(oldStatuses, newStatuses *v1.PodStatus, podSpec *v1.PodSpec) error {
// If we should always restart, containers are allowed to leave the terminated state
if podSpec.RestartPolicy == v1.RestartPolicyAlways {
return nil
}
for _, oldStatus := range oldStatuses.ContainerStatuses {
// Skip any container that wasn't terminated
if oldStatus.State.Terminated == nil {
continue
}
// Skip any container that failed but is allowed to restart
if oldStatus.State.Terminated.ExitCode != 0 && podSpec.RestartPolicy == v1.RestartPolicyOnFailure {
continue
}
for _, newStatus := range newStatuses.ContainerStatuses {
if oldStatus.Name == newStatus.Name && newStatus.State.Terminated == nil {
return fmt.Errorf("terminated container %v attempted illegal transition to non-terminated state", newStatus.Name)
}
}
}
for i, oldStatus := range oldStatuses.InitContainerStatuses {
initContainer, ok := kubeutil.GetContainerByIndex(podSpec.InitContainers, oldStatuses.InitContainerStatuses, i)
if !ok {
return fmt.Errorf("found mismatch between pod spec and status, container: %v", oldStatus.Name)
}
// Skip any restartable init container as it always is allowed to restart
if kubetypes.IsRestartableInitContainer(&initContainer) {
continue
}
// Skip any container that wasn't terminated
if oldStatus.State.Terminated == nil {
continue
}
// Skip any container that failed but is allowed to restart
if oldStatus.State.Terminated.ExitCode != 0 && podSpec.RestartPolicy == v1.RestartPolicyOnFailure {
continue
}
for _, newStatus := range newStatuses.InitContainerStatuses {
if oldStatus.Name == newStatus.Name && newStatus.State.Terminated == nil {
return fmt.Errorf("terminated init container %v attempted illegal transition to non-terminated state", newStatus.Name)
}
}
}
return nil
}
// updateStatusInternal updates the internal status cache, and queues an update to the api server if
// necessary.
// This method IS NOT THREAD SAFE and must be called from a locked function.
func (m *manager) updateStatusInternal(pod *v1.Pod, status v1.PodStatus, forceUpdate, podIsFinished bool) {
var oldStatus v1.PodStatus
cachedStatus, isCached := m.podStatuses[pod.UID]
if isCached {
oldStatus = cachedStatus.status
// TODO(#116484): Also assign terminal phase to static pods.
if !kubetypes.IsStaticPod(pod) {
if cachedStatus.podIsFinished && !podIsFinished {
klog.InfoS("Got unexpected podIsFinished=false, while podIsFinished=true in status cache, programmer error.", "pod", klog.KObj(pod))
podIsFinished = true
}
}
} else if mirrorPod, ok := m.podManager.GetMirrorPodByPod(pod); ok {
oldStatus = mirrorPod.Status
} else {
oldStatus = pod.Status
}
// Check for illegal state transition in containers
if err := checkContainerStateTransition(&oldStatus, &status, &pod.Spec); err != nil {
klog.ErrorS(err, "Status update on pod aborted", "pod", klog.KObj(pod))
return
}
// Set ContainersReadyCondition.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, v1.ContainersReady)
// Set ReadyCondition.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, v1.PodReady)
// Set InitializedCondition.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, v1.PodInitialized)
// Set PodReadyToStartContainersCondition.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, kubetypes.PodReadyToStartContainers)
// Set PodScheduledCondition.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, v1.PodScheduled)
if utilfeature.DefaultFeatureGate.Enabled(features.PodDisruptionConditions) {
// Set DisruptionTarget.LastTransitionTime.
updateLastTransitionTime(&status, &oldStatus, v1.DisruptionTarget)
}
// ensure that the start time does not change across updates.
if oldStatus.StartTime != nil && !oldStatus.StartTime.IsZero() {
status.StartTime = oldStatus.StartTime
} else if status.StartTime.IsZero() {
// if the status has no start time, we need to set an initial time
now := metav1.Now()
status.StartTime = &now
}
normalizeStatus(pod, &status)
// Perform some more extensive logging of container termination state to assist in
// debugging production races (generally not needed).
if klogV := klog.V(5); klogV.Enabled() {
var containers []string
for _, s := range append(append([]v1.ContainerStatus(nil), status.InitContainerStatuses...), status.ContainerStatuses...) {
var current, previous string
switch {
case s.State.Running != nil:
current = "running"
case s.State.Waiting != nil:
current = "waiting"
case s.State.Terminated != nil:
current = fmt.Sprintf("terminated=%d", s.State.Terminated.ExitCode)
default:
current = "unknown"
}
switch {
case s.LastTerminationState.Running != nil:
previous = "running"
case s.LastTerminationState.Waiting != nil:
previous = "waiting"
case s.LastTerminationState.Terminated != nil:
previous = fmt.Sprintf("terminated=%d", s.LastTerminationState.Terminated.ExitCode)
default:
previous = "<none>"
}
containers = append(containers, fmt.Sprintf("(%s state=%s previous=%s)", s.Name, current, previous))
}
sort.Strings(containers)
klogV.InfoS("updateStatusInternal", "version", cachedStatus.version+1, "podIsFinished", podIsFinished, "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ID, "containers", strings.Join(containers, " "))
}
// The intent here is to prevent concurrent updates to a pod's status from
// clobbering each other so the phase of a pod progresses monotonically.
if isCached && isPodStatusByKubeletEqual(&cachedStatus.status, &status) && !forceUpdate {
klog.V(3).InfoS("Ignoring same status for pod",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"status", status)
return
}
newStatus := versionedPodStatus{
status: status,
version: cachedStatus.version + 1,
podName: pod.Name,
podNamespace: pod.Namespace,
podIsFinished: podIsFinished,
}
// Multiple status updates can be generated before we update the API server,
// so we track the time from the first status update until we retire it to
// the API.
if cachedStatus.at.IsZero() {
newStatus.at = time.Now()
} else {
newStatus.at = cachedStatus.at
}
m.podStatuses[pod.UID] = newStatus
select {
case m.podStatusChannel <- struct{}{}:
default:
// there's already a status update pending
}
}
// updateLastTransitionTime updates the LastTransitionTime of a pod condition.
func updateLastTransitionTime(status, oldStatus *v1.PodStatus, conditionType v1.PodConditionType) {
_, condition := podutil.GetPodCondition(status, conditionType)
if condition == nil {
return
}
// Need to set LastTransitionTime.
lastTransitionTime := metav1.Now()
_, oldCondition := podutil.GetPodCondition(oldStatus, conditionType)
if oldCondition != nil && condition.Status == oldCondition.Status {
lastTransitionTime = oldCondition.LastTransitionTime
}
condition.LastTransitionTime = lastTransitionTime
}

// syncBatch syncs pods statuses with the apiserver. Returns the number of syncs
// attempted for testing.
func (m *manager) syncBatch(all bool) int {
type podSync struct {
podUID types.UID
statusUID kubetypes.MirrorPodUID
status versionedPodStatus
}
var updatedStatuses []podSync
podToMirror, mirrorToPod := m.podManager.GetUIDTranslations()
func() { // Critical section
m.podStatusesLock.RLock()
defer m.podStatusesLock.RUnlock()
// Clean up orphaned versions.
if all {
for uid := range m.apiStatusVersions {
_, hasPod := m.podStatuses[types.UID(uid)]
_, hasMirror := mirrorToPod[uid]
if !hasPod && !hasMirror {
delete(m.apiStatusVersions, uid)
}
}
}
// Decide which pods need status updates.
for uid, status := range m.podStatuses {
// translate the pod UID (source) to the status UID (API pod) -
// static pods are identified in source by pod UID but tracked in the
// API via the uid of the mirror pod
uidOfStatus := kubetypes.MirrorPodUID(uid)
if mirrorUID, ok := podToMirror[kubetypes.ResolvedPodUID(uid)]; ok {
if mirrorUID == "" {
klog.V(5).InfoS("Static pod does not have a corresponding mirror pod; skipping",
"podUID", uid,
"pod", klog.KRef(status.podNamespace, status.podName))
continue
}
uidOfStatus = mirrorUID
}
// if a new status update has been delivered, trigger an update, otherwise the
// pod can wait for the next bulk check (which performs reconciliation as well)
if !all {
if m.apiStatusVersions[uidOfStatus] >= status.version {
continue
}
updatedStatuses = append(updatedStatuses, podSync{uid, uidOfStatus, status})
continue
}
// Ensure that any new status, or mismatched status, or pod that is ready for
// deletion gets updated. If a status update fails we retry the next time any
// other pod is updated.
if m.needsUpdate(types.UID(uidOfStatus), status) {
updatedStatuses = append(updatedStatuses, podSync{uid, uidOfStatus, status})
} else if m.needsReconcile(uid, status.status) {
// Delete the apiStatusVersions here to force an update on the pod status
// In most cases the deleted apiStatusVersions here should be filled
// soon after the following syncPod() [If the syncPod() sync an update
// successfully].
delete(m.apiStatusVersions, uidOfStatus)
updatedStatuses = append(updatedStatuses, podSync{uid, uidOfStatus, status})
}
}
}()
for _, update := range updatedStatuses {
klog.V(5).InfoS("Sync pod status", "podUID", update.podUID, "statusUID", update.statusUID, "version", update.status.version)
m.syncPod(update.podUID, update.status)
}
return len(updatedStatuses)
}
// syncPod syncs the given status with the API server. The caller must not hold the status lock.
func (m *manager) syncPod(uid types.UID, status versionedPodStatus) {
// TODO: make me easier to express from client code
pod, err := m.kubeClient.CoreV1().Pods(status.podNamespace).Get(context.TODO(), status.podName, metav1.GetOptions{})
if errors.IsNotFound(err) {
klog.V(3).InfoS("Pod does not exist on the server",
"podUID", uid,
"pod", klog.KRef(status.podNamespace, status.podName))
// If the Pod is deleted the status will be cleared in
// RemoveOrphanedStatuses, so we just ignore the update here.
return
}
if err != nil {
klog.InfoS("Failed to get status for pod",
"podUID", uid,
"pod", klog.KRef(status.podNamespace, status.podName),
"err", err)
return
}
translatedUID := m.podManager.TranslatePodUID(pod.UID)
// Type convert original uid just for the purpose of comparison.
if len(translatedUID) > 0 && translatedUID != kubetypes.ResolvedPodUID(uid) {
klog.V(2).InfoS("Pod was deleted and then recreated, skipping status update",
"pod", klog.KObj(pod),
"oldPodUID", uid,
"podUID", translatedUID)
m.deletePodStatus(uid)
return
}
mergedStatus := mergePodStatus(pod.Status, status.status, m.podDeletionSafety.PodCouldHaveRunningContainers(pod))
newPod, patchBytes, unchanged, err := statusutil.PatchPodStatus(context.TODO(), m.kubeClient, pod.Namespace, pod.Name, pod.UID, pod.Status, mergedStatus)
klog.V(3).InfoS("Patch status for pod",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", uid, "patch", string(patchBytes))
if err != nil {
klog.InfoS("Failed to update status for pod",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"err", err)
return
}
if unchanged {
klog.V(3).InfoS("Status for pod is up-to-date",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"statusVersion", status.version)
} else {
klog.V(3).InfoS("Status for pod updated successfully",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"statusVersion", status.version, "status", mergedStatus)
pod = newPod
// We pass a new object (result of API call which contains updated ResourceVersion)
m.podStartupLatencyHelper.RecordStatusUpdated(pod)
}
// measure how long the status update took to propagate from generation to update on the server
if status.at.IsZero() {
klog.V(3).InfoS("Pod had no status time set",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", uid, "version", status.version)
} else {
duration := time.Since(status.at).Truncate(time.Millisecond)
metrics.PodStatusSyncDuration.Observe(duration.Seconds())
}
m.apiStatusVersions[kubetypes.MirrorPodUID(pod.UID)] = status.version
// We don't handle graceful deletion of mirror pods.
if m.canBeDeleted(pod, status.status, status.podIsFinished) {
deleteOptions := metav1.DeleteOptions{
GracePeriodSeconds: new(int64),
// Use the pod UID as the precondition for deletion to prevent deleting a
// newly created pod with the same name and namespace.
Preconditions: metav1.NewUIDPreconditions(string(pod.UID)),
}
err = m.kubeClient.CoreV1().Pods(pod.Namespace).Delete(context.TODO(), pod.Name, deleteOptions)
if err != nil {
klog.InfoS("Failed to delete status for pod", "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"err", err)
return
}
klog.V(3).InfoS("Pod fully terminated and removed from etcd", "pod", klog.KObj(pod))
m.deletePodStatus(uid)
}
}
// needsUpdate returns whether the status is stale for the given pod UID.
// This method is not thread safe, and must only be accessed by the sync thread.
func (m *manager) needsUpdate(uid types.UID, status versionedPodStatus) bool {
latest, ok := m.apiStatusVersions[kubetypes.MirrorPodUID(uid)]
if !ok || latest < status.version {
return true
}
pod, ok := m.podManager.GetPodByUID(uid)
if !ok {
return false
}
return m.canBeDeleted(pod, status.status, status.podIsFinished)
}
func (m *manager) canBeDeleted(pod *v1.Pod, status v1.PodStatus, podIsFinished bool) bool {
if pod.DeletionTimestamp == nil || kubetypes.IsMirrorPod(pod) {
return false
}
// Delay deletion of pods until the phase is terminal, based on pod.Status
// which comes from pod manager.
if !podutil.IsPodPhaseTerminal(pod.Status.Phase) {
// For debugging purposes we also log the kubelet's local phase, when the deletion is delayed.
klog.V(3).InfoS("Delaying pod deletion as the phase is non-terminal", "phase", pod.Status.Phase, "localPhase", status.Phase, "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
return false
}
// If this is an update completing pod termination then we know the pod termination is finished.
if podIsFinished {
klog.V(3).InfoS("The pod termination is finished as SyncTerminatedPod completes its execution", "phase", pod.Status.Phase, "localPhase", status.Phase, "pod", klog.KObj(pod), "podUID", pod.UID)
return true
}
return false
}
// needsReconcile compares the given status with the status in the pod manager (which
// in fact comes from apiserver), returns whether the status needs to be reconciled with
// the apiserver. Now when pod status is inconsistent between apiserver and kubelet,
// kubelet should forcibly send an update to reconcile the inconsistence, because kubelet
// should be the source of truth of pod status.
// NOTE(random-liu): It's simpler to pass in mirror pod uid and get mirror pod by uid, but
// now the pod manager only supports getting mirror pod by static pod, so we have to pass
// static pod uid here.
// TODO(random-liu): Simplify the logic when mirror pod manager is added.
func (m *manager) needsReconcile(uid types.UID, status v1.PodStatus) bool {
// The pod could be a static pod, so we should translate first.
pod, ok := m.podManager.GetPodByUID(uid)
if !ok {
klog.V(4).InfoS("Pod has been deleted, no need to reconcile", "podUID", string(uid))
return false
}
// If the pod is a static pod, we should check its mirror pod, because only status in mirror pod is meaningful to us.
if kubetypes.IsStaticPod(pod) {
mirrorPod, ok := m.podManager.GetMirrorPodByPod(pod)
if !ok {
klog.V(4).InfoS("Static pod has no corresponding mirror pod, no need to reconcile", "pod", klog.KObj(pod))
return false
}
pod = mirrorPod
}
podStatus := pod.Status.DeepCopy()
normalizeStatus(pod, podStatus)
if isPodStatusByKubeletEqual(podStatus, &status) {
// If the status from the source is the same with the cached status,
// reconcile is not needed. Just return.
return false
}
klog.V(3).InfoS("Pod status is inconsistent with cached status for pod, a reconciliation should be triggered",
"pod", klog.KObj(pod),
"statusDiff", cmp.Diff(podStatus, &status))
return true
}
